什么是数据库中的作业
-
在数据库中,作业指的是一系列的任务或操作,用于处理和管理数据库中的数据。作业的目的是执行特定的功能或任务,如数据导入、数据清理、数据转换、数据备份、数据恢复等。
以下是数据库中的作业的五个常见示例:
-
数据导入作业:这种作业用于将外部数据源中的数据导入到数据库中。例如,从Excel文件中导入数据到数据库表中。这种作业通常会涉及数据校验、数据转换和数据加载等过程。
-
数据清理作业:这种作业用于清理数据库中的无效、重复或不一致的数据。例如,删除重复的记录、修复错误的数据、删除过期的数据等。数据清理作业通常会根据预定义的规则或条件对数据进行筛选和处理。
-
数据转换作业:这种作业用于将数据库中的数据转换为不同的格式或结构。例如,将数据库中的数据转换为XML、JSON或CSV格式,或将数据从一个数据库迁移到另一个数据库。
-
数据备份作业:这种作业用于定期备份数据库中的数据,以防止数据丢失或损坏。数据备份作业通常会将数据库的完整备份或增量备份保存到本地磁盘或远程存储设备中。
-
数据恢复作业:这种作业用于在数据库发生故障或数据丢失时恢复数据。数据恢复作业通常会根据备份文件或日志文件来还原数据库的状态,以确保数据的完整性和一致性。
总结来说,数据库中的作业是一种用于处理和管理数据库中数据的任务或操作。这些作业可以包括数据导入、数据清理、数据转换、数据备份和数据恢复等功能。通过使用作业,可以有效地处理和维护数据库中的数据,确保数据的质量和可用性。
1年前 -
-
数据库中的作业是指在数据库管理系统(DBMS)中执行的任务或操作。作业可以是数据库管理员(DBA)或其他用户定义和安排的一系列数据库操作,通常用于实现特定的功能或完成特定的任务。
数据库中的作业可以包括以下几个方面:
-
数据库备份和恢复作业:数据库备份是将数据库的数据和结构拷贝到其他存储设备中,以便在数据丢失或损坏时进行恢复。数据库恢复是将备份的数据还原到数据库中。DBA通常会定期执行备份作业,以确保数据的安全性和可恢复性。
-
数据库优化作业:数据库优化是通过调整数据库的结构和查询语句等方式,提高数据库的性能和效率。DBA可以通过定期分析数据库的性能指标,如查询响应时间、磁盘使用率等,来确定需要进行优化的作业,并采取相应的措施来提升数据库的性能。
-
数据库维护作业:数据库维护是指定期对数据库进行检查、修复和优化,以保持数据库的正常运行和稳定性。维护作业可以包括数据库索引的重建、数据碎片的清理、统计信息的更新等。这些维护作业可以帮助提高数据库的性能和减少故障的发生。
-
数据库导入和导出作业:数据库导入是将外部数据导入到数据库中,数据库导出是将数据库中的数据导出到外部文件中。这些作业可以用于数据迁移、数据交换和数据备份等场景。
-
数据库定期任务:数据库中的定期任务是指按照预定的时间间隔执行的任务,如定时生成报表、定时清理过期数据等。这些作业通常通过定时任务调度器来实现,可以自动执行,减少人工操作的工作量。
总之,数据库中的作业是指在数据库管理系统中执行的任务或操作,包括备份和恢复、优化、维护、导入和导出以及定期任务等。通过合理安排和执行这些作业,可以确保数据库的安全性、性能和稳定性。
1年前 -
-
数据库中的作业是指在数据库管理系统中定义和执行的一组任务或操作。它们用于自动化和管理数据库中的各种任务,如数据导入、数据转换、数据清洗、数据备份等。数据库作业可以根据需求定期或按需执行,以提高数据库的效率和可靠性。
在数据库中,作业通常由一系列的SQL语句组成,这些SQL语句可以是查询、插入、更新或删除操作。作业也可以包含存储过程、函数和触发器等数据库对象。作业可以根据预定义的时间表或事件触发器进行调度,也可以手动触发执行。
下面是一个典型的数据库作业的操作流程:
-
定义作业:首先,需要在数据库管理系统中创建一个作业。这可以通过使用特定的命令或图形用户界面工具来完成。在创建作业时,需要指定作业的名称、描述、执行时间表和所需的权限等。
-
编写作业脚本:接下来,需要编写作业脚本,即包含一系列SQL语句的文件。这些SQL语句定义了作业要执行的具体任务,如数据导入、数据转换或数据备份等。在编写作业脚本时,需要考虑数据的完整性和一致性,以及执行顺序和依赖关系。
-
调度作业:一旦作业定义和脚本编写完成,就可以将作业调度到数据库管理系统中执行。作业可以根据预定的时间表进行调度,如每天、每周或每月执行一次,也可以根据事件触发器进行调度,如在数据变化时自动触发执行。
-
执行作业:当作业被调度执行时,数据库管理系统会按照作业脚本中定义的顺序逐个执行SQL语句。在执行过程中,系统会记录执行日志和错误信息,以便后续的监控和故障排除。
-
监控作业:在作业执行过程中,可以通过数据库管理系统提供的监控工具来实时监控作业的状态和进度。这些工具可以显示作业的执行时间、资源消耗和错误信息等,以帮助管理员及时发现和解决问题。
-
完成作业:一旦作业执行完毕,数据库管理系统会生成执行报告,其中包含作业执行的详细信息,如执行时间、执行结果和错误日志等。管理员可以根据这些报告进行作业的评估和调整,以提高作业的效率和可靠性。
总之,数据库中的作业是一种自动化执行任务的方式,可以帮助管理员提高数据库的管理效率和数据的一致性。通过合理设计和调度作业,可以实现对数据库的定期维护、数据处理和备份等操作,从而保证数据库的稳定和可靠性。
1年前 -